Analytical Engineer
- Remote
- Data and Analytics
Job description
Your Mission as Analytical Engineer:
One thing we love at Ancient Gaming is turning complex data into powerful insights that drive our growth. As a company focused on delivering the best products, we’re looking for someone ready to continue building the cornerstone of our Business Intelligence Data team. In this role, you'll be the architect and owner of our core data models, working to transform raw data into a reliable, high-quality asset that empowers our entire organization.
This role requires a deep understanding of data warehousing principles, a knack for solving complex business problems with data, and the technical expertise to build scalable solutions. You'll be instrumental in shaping our data ecosystem and driving a data-driven culture.
You will be working on:
CSGORoll — the world’s #1 skin gaming site. A community social gaming platform specifically designed for CS2 players, featuring unique in-house custom-built games, such as Roulette, Crash, Unboxing, and PVP.
HypeDrop — a leading gamified shopping platform, where over 500,000 users experience the excitement of real-time mystery box openings, box battles, and customizable deals. Since 2018, HypeDrop has sold over 150 million boxes, revolutionizing the way people shop and win.
Your Mission:
Design and Build Data Models: You'll own the full lifecycle of our data models. Using dbt (data build tool), you will design, build, and maintain complex, business-critical data models in BigQuery that are performant, scalable, and well-documented
Improve Data Quality and Governance: Take ownership of data integrity. You'll define and implement robust data quality tests, documentation, and governance standards to ensure the accuracy and trustworthiness of our data assets
Orchestrate and Optimize Pipelines: Schedule and automate dbt runs and other transformation jobs using Airflow on Google Cloud Platform (GCP). You'll also identify and implement opportunities to optimize query performance and reduce data warehouse costs
Translate Business Needs: Work closely with stakeholders across the company—from data analysts to product managers—to understand their data requirements. You'll translate complex business logic into clear, maintainable data models and metrics
Version Control: Use GitHub for version control, collaborative development, and code reviews, following best practices for branching and pull requests
Lead Projects: Take the lead on projects to integrate new data sources, refactor existing data pipelines, or implement new data governance frameworks
Support Business Data Requirements: Ensure stakeholders across the business receive the data they need through reports, ad-hoc requests and dashboards
Job requirements
Your Superpowers:
3+ years of professional experience in a data-focused role, such as Analytical Engineer, Data Warehouse Developer, or similar
Expert-level proficiency in SQL. You should be comfortable writing and optimizing complex queries, stored procedures and window functions
Extensive experience with dbt. You should be familiar with advanced dbt concepts, including macros, packages and custom testing frameworks
Proven experience with Google Cloud Platform (GCP), specifically with BigQuery and other services like Cloud Storage
Hands-on experience with Apache Airflow for orchestrating data pipelines and familiarity with Python
Proficient with GitHub for version control, code reviews, and collaborative development workflows
A strong understanding of data warehousing design principles (e.g., Kimball, Inmon) and data modeling methodologies
Excellent communication and stakeholder management skills, with a track record of translating technical concepts to non-technical audiences
Nice to Have:
Experience with a BI tool like Sigma, Looker, Tableau, or Power BI.
Experience with other GCP services like Dataflow, Cloud Functions, or Pub/Sub.
Growth & Impact: At Ancient Gaming, your role isn’t set in stone. It evolves as fast as we do. We believe in growing with the company, pushing your limits and leveling up every day. Personal development isn’t just encouraged. It’s built into everything we do!
Ready to shape your own path and expand your skills?
No Role Titles Needed: We are not about fitting into boxes. Whether you are a specialist, a generalist, or somewhere in between, if you bring a unique T-shaped skill set and the drive to make an impact, WE WANT YOU ON OUR TEAM!
The Perks That Actually Matter:
Work From Literally Anywhere – Beach in Bali? Mountain cabin? City apartment? Your call.
Annual Team Meetups in Epic Locations – Previous destinations have included vibrant European capitals, tropical islands, and adventure hubs
Home Office Budget – Get the setup you need to do your best work
Growth Fund – Dedicated budget for courses, conferences, and skill development (plus unlimited Udemy access)
Mental Health Support through Spill – Because creative brains need care too
Be Part of Something Big - We're growing fast, which means unlimited opportunities to level up your career
Our "Not-So-Secret" Secret Sauce:
We Get Shit Done – No endless meetings or analysis paralysis. We move fast
Failure = Learning – We celebrate bold attempts, not just successes
Remote-First, Not Remote-Compromise – Our distributed team is our strength, not an afterthought
Player Obsessed – Every design decision starts and ends with our users
or
Your application has been received! 💙
Thank you so much for applying! We’re excited to review your submission and aim to get back to you with feedback within the next 2 weeks. In the meantime, keep an eye on your email—and don’t forget to check your spam folder just in case!